Bitcoin Plunges to Ten-Day Low as $700 Million in Liquidations Hit Crypto Market

The Bitcoin price has taken a sharp turn downward after a brief rally to $65,600 on Monday. The asset has lost over $3,000 in hours and is now trading at a ten-day low of $63,190.

The downturn has affected most altcoins, leading to significant liquidations totaling around $700 million in the past 24 hours.

Cryptocurrency analyst CRYPTOWZRD notes that Bitcoin's bearish close suggests it needs to stay above $63,000 for now; otherwise, it could drop to new local lows.

The market slump comes ahead of the US Federal Reserve's interest rate decision, which is expected to be announced tomorrow and may impact risk-on assets like crypto.
